Kitchen furniture manufacturing is a sophisticated and dynamic industry that blends craftsmanship with cutting-edge technology. The process begins with understanding consumer needs, kitchen trends, and ergonomic requirements. Manufacturers design cabinetry, countertops, islands, and storage systems that mustn't only be functional but in addition complement the aesthetic of modern homes. This calls for collaboration between industrial designers, engineers, and craftsmen to create furniture that meets quality, durability, and style standards. From basic cabinet carcasses to intricate shelving and drawer systems, every element should be crafted with precision.

One of the very critical facets of kitchen furniture manufacturing is the choice of materials. Solid wood, plywood, medium- Virtuves baldu gamyba vilniusfiberboard (MDF), particleboard, and laminated boards are commonly used with respect to the quality and price point. Each material offers unique benefits—wood for durability and premium appearance, MDF for smooth finishes and easy customization, and plywood for moisture resistance. Additionally, components like hinges, drawer slides, handles, and surface finishes (like laminates, veneers, or acrylics) play an integral role in the functionality and aesthetics of the ultimate product.

Before manufacturing begins, designers use CAD (Computer-Aided Design) and CAM (Computer-Aided Manufacturing) software to map out precise kitchen layouts. These tools enable customized design centered on kitchen dimensions, plumbing points, and electrical layouts. Every cabinet, drawer, and shelf should be positioned for optimal functionality. This stage also includes selecting color schemes, finishes, and detailing that match the customer's preferences. Manufacturers often use 3D modeling to provide clients a digital walkthrough of the planned kitchen, helping them visualize the end product.

Once the style is finalized, the production process begins. Raw materials are cut to size using CNC (Computer Numerical Control) machines for accuracy. Edge banding machines apply a clean finish to raw edges, while drilling machines create pre-set holes for screws and hardware. Assembly can be achieved manually or using automated systems, depending on the scale of the factory. Finishing processes include sanding, painting, lacquering, or laminating to enhance the visual appeal and durability of the furniture. Strict quality checks ensure each piece meets manufacturing standards before it moves to packaging.

In kitchen furniture manufacturing, quality control is an essential step to make sure safety, durability, and customer satisfaction. Manufacturers conduct rigorous tests on materials and finished products. These generally include load testing shelves and drawers, checking water and moisture resistance, inspecting joints and fasteners, and ensuring surfaces are free of defects. Certifications like ISO, FSC (Forest Stewardship Council), and CARB compliance tend to be required for several markets. High-end manufacturers may go an action further by using eco-friendly paints, anti-bacterial coatings, and fire-retardant materials to make sure premium quality.
